Onboarding note for the Ledgerpane admin table: bulk edits are applied through the batcher service, not directly against the database. Select rows, choose an action, and the batcher stages changes in a pending set you can review before commit. Edits over 500 rows require a second approver — this is enforced server-side, so don't try to chunk around it. To run the batcher locally you need the staging write credential, which goes in your .env as the next line.

secret setting of bahip-kagag: RELAY_SECRET3=c83

Quick one for the sync: step 3 of the Korrel KV migration puts the new bloom filter in front of the store. Expect a short spike in false-positive lookups while it warms up — that's fine, don't page anyone. Once the filter's warm, make sure prod matches the settings below.

deployment values, fadug-bawig:
WENETH_PIN=3401
WENETH_TENANT=praath
WENETH_METRICS_HOST=metrics.weneth.tolvaqdata.corp
WENETH_SEAL=seal_d9652c70
WENETH_STANDBY_TEAM=gilion

The expand-contract migration for Coppervault's ledger table stalls at the backfill step when replication lag exceeds 30s. Writers stay healthy, but the contract phase never triggers, leaving dual-write mode on indefinitely and doubling write amplification. Workaround: pause backfill, let lag drain, resume. Permanent fix adds lag-aware throttling to the migration runner. No downtime observed in staging across three full runs. Requesting inclusion in this week's train. Validated against the build below.

pipeline stamp: htk3_69f